Each review score is between 1-10. To get the overall score that you see, we add up all the review scores we’ve received and divide that total by the number of review scores we’ve received. We are currently testing a weighted review system in Malta and Iceland (excluding hotel and vacation rental chains). For properties in these countries, the more recent the review, the bigger the impact on the total review score calculation. In addition, guests can give separate ‘subscores’ in crucial areas, such as location, cleanliness, staff, comfort, facilities, value for money and free Wi-Fi. Note that guests submit their subscores and their overall scores independently, so there’s no direct link between them.

We stayed here for 17 nights and were heart broken when we had to leave. Looking at the map, I was convinced it was a good 15 minute walk to the port (where most of the bars and restaurants are), but it is actually only 2-3 minutes, in a quiet and safe side street. Located up 2 flights of stairs, so possibly not suitable for the very elderly or infirm, but we had no issues with this. The room itself was a fantastic size, with a large en-suite bathroom. There is a second room beside this, so perfect for families or groups of friends traveling. Very stylishly decorated and equipped with a hob, full sized fridge with ice box and both a kettle and coffee machine. There was as a small grill/oven, so you could easily cook for a family if required. Also a washing machine and drying lines are available for quests which was very convenient. Room was serviced every day and always fresh towels if required. Air conditioning was great and made all the difference during the heatwave on the last few days of our stay. Breakfast was great and was served on the wonderful roof terrace that is available to use through out your stay. Home made cakes, buns and tarts and a selection of savoury items offered every morning that gave lots of variety. Lots of shelter on the roof terrace too to hide from the sun if required. The main high point were our hosts Marriam, Vicky and Grazia. From the moment we arrived we were treated like family and we left as genuine friends. They really could not do enough to make our stay more enjoyable, both in advance and when we were there. Such thoughtful and friendly people in so many ways. We hope to go back again next year, which I guess is the ultimate vote of confidence! There must be 400-500 B&Bs in Trani, but I really believe you would struggle to find better than La Grazia B&B.
